BBBY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

201 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bed Bath & Beyond Inc (BBBY)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$135M — down 52% from $284M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 37 funds opened new BBBY posit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 76 added to existing stakes and 45 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Invesco, adding an estimated $5.4M. The largest seller was Marshall Wace,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.87M sold.
